    In this contribution the model and the real bulk rod- and needle-like materials, wherein one dimension is significantly higher than the other two, are rheologically tested. Standardization was
    carried on a vibratory shaker. The breakable stirrer was assessed for measuring the stability, which represents the points of energy required to pass the stirrer through the bulk material. The compression curves are accompanied by granulometric curves, from which can be deduced, when the loose materials begin to break.
